Attorney Bruce E. Loren is a partner with Loren & Kean Law, which has law offices in Palm Beach Gardens and Fort Lauderdale, Florida. Board-certified in Construction Law by The Florida Bar Board of Legal Specialization and Education and possessing more than 34 years of total legal experience, Mr. Loren provides unmatched representation to clients throughout Palm Beach and Broward counties and the rest of South Florida who have legal needs involving any of the following:

Along with his certification in construction law, Mr. Loren is also a U.S. Green Building Council LEED Accredited Professional, and he once served as chairman for the Palm Beach County Green Task Force on Environmental Sustainability and Conservation. He is also a member of the U.S. Green Building Council, South Florida Chapter as well as the Associated General Contractors of America, the Construction Association of South Florida, the Executives' Association of the Palm Beaches and the International Factoring Association.
A 1986 cum laude graduate of State University of New York at Albany, Mr. Loren obtained his Juris Doctor cum laude from Brooklyn Law School in 1989. The New York State Bar Association admitted him to practice that same year, and he received his license to practice in Florida in 1992.
He is also admitted to practice before the U.S. District Courts for the Southern and Eastern Districts of New York and the Middle and Southern Districts of Florida as well as before the U.S. Court of Appeals for the 2nd and 11th Circuits. He is an active member of The Florida Bar, the New York State Bar Association and the Palm Beach County Bar Association, among his other professional affiliations.
